Is Solo Travel Safe?

Safety is one of the main worries of first-time tourists. The good news is that if you plan ahead, traveling alone may be really secure.

Safety Tips

  • Research your destination before traveling.
  • Tell your loved ones or friends about your itinerary.
  • Keep digital copies of important documents.
  • Avoid displaying expensive belongings.
  • Stay aware of your surroundings.
  • Choose accommodations with good reviews.
  • Use trusted transportation services.
  • Carry emergency contact information.

Being prepared reduces risks and helps you enjoy your journey with confidence.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Is solo travel good for beginners?

Yes. Start with a safe destination that has reliable transportation and good tourist infrastructure.

Is solo travel expensive?

Not necessarily. Budget travelers can reduce costs by staying in hostels, using public transportation, and planning ahead.

Which country is safest for solo travelers?

Japan, Switzerland, New Zealand, Portugal, and Singapore are often recommended for their safety and ease of travel.

What should I pack for solo travel?

Carry essential documents, comfortable clothing, toiletries, a first-aid kit, a power bank, and emergency contact information.

How can I stay connected while traveling?

Consider buying a local SIM card or using an international eSIM. Free Wi-Fi is also widely available in many destinations.
